Transworld’s 2010 Halloween and Haunted Attraction Tradeshow is coming back to St. Louis March 25-28, 2010 and during the show The Darkness haunted house will open again to the haunt industry on three different nights. The 2009 Darkness tour was a bigger success than we had ever anticipated. This year we have limited the amount of guests per night to ensure a better experience for those who attend. The Darkness is undergoing a massive overhaul at a cost in excess of $200,000.00 prior to the 2010 Transworld Haunt Show.

The Darkness is three attractions in one 30,000 square foot building, which includes The Darkness, Terror Visions in 3D and a Monster Museum. All three of our attractions have been improved, renovated and or totally overhauled for the tour during the Transworld Haunt Show. So what will you see this year that you didn’t see last year?

Over 80% of the entire second floor of The Darkness was removed and rebuilt from scratch. The Darkness will feature several major animated effects that will scare entire groups of guests at the same time including a falling barrel effect, a major water scare animation and a really cool dropping ceiling. The Darkness will also feature tens of thousands of dollars of never before seen props, animations, and sets that will leave haunt owners amazed.

Terror Visions will unveil an amazing array of 3D effects never before seen or attempted and the monster museum will include all new full sized monsters.

Three tours are being offered… the first on Thursday March 25, 2010 prepare to take a new Behind the Scenes tour which this year includes tours through our World Class Actors Room, Halloween Productions workshop, and all thru the all new Darkness. If you want to see The Darkness with actors this year we offer one tour Friday night and another on Saturday night from 7:30pm until 11:30pm.

In 1972, a scale of measurement was established for alien encounters. When a UFO is sighted, it is called an encounter of the first kind. When evidence is collected, it is known as an encounter of the second kind. When contact is made with extraterrestrials, it is the third kind. The next level, abduction, is the fourth kind.
